A QUICK READ

What the numbers say about Oberlin College

What does Oberlin College cost?

Oberlin College reports an average annual net price of $38,645 after grants and scholarships. This is an institution-wide average, not an individual aid offer.

What do Oberlin College graduates earn?

The observed median earnings figure is $48,586 5 years after completion. It describes a federal cohort, not a guaranteed starting salary.

How much federal debt do Oberlin College graduates have?

Completer borrowers report median cumulative federal student debt of $26,000. Parent PLUS and private loans are not included.

Is every degree at Oberlin College worth the same?

No. DegreeVerdict currently shows 14 field-and-credential outcomes at Oberlin College; reported earnings and debt can differ substantially by program category.

PROGRAM PAYOFF SPREAD

The college average is not the whole story.

Observed earnings vary substantially by field and credential at the same institution.

1Computer and Information Sciences, General · Bachelor's Degree$129,3952Economics · Bachelor's Degree$87,1203Political Science and Government · Bachelor's Degree$70,6894History · Bachelor's Degree$60,8955Area Studies · Bachelor's Degree$55,1516English Language and Literature, General · Bachelor's Degree$49,9067Psychology, General · Bachelor's Degree$48,1098Natural Resources Conservation and Research · Bachelor's Degree$46,580

Observed year-4 earnings · compare like fields and credentials before deciding
